Infantile Amnesia
The inability of adults to recall memories from early childhood, typically before age 3 or 4.
Maturation
The process of development in which an individual matures or reaches full functionality and growth, often independent of learning or experience.
Colicky Baby
Refers to an otherwise healthy infant who cries excessively and inconsolably, often due to gastrointestinal discomfort.
Schemas
Mental structures that people use to organize their knowledge about the social world around themes or subjects and that influence the information people notice, think about, and remember.
